What does an overnight hotel employee do?

An overnight hotel employee, often called a night auditor or night shift staff, is responsible for managing the hotel’s front desk and operations during nighttime hours. Their duties typically include checking in late arrivals, processing guest requests, balancing the day’s financial transactions, and preparing reports for management. They also handle security checks and respond to any emergencies or guest concerns that arise overnight. This role requires strong customer service sk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ently.

What are the main challenges faced by overnight hotel staff, and how can they be managed effectively?

Overnight hotel staff often work with limited supervision and must handle a variety of tasks, from late check-ins to addressing guest emergencies. Common challenges include staying alert during quiet hours, resolving unexpected issues like maintenance requests or noise complaints, and ensuring guest safety. Effective time management, strong problem-solving skills, and clear communication with other team members and departments (like housekeeping or security) are key to managing these challenges successfully. Regularly checking in with colleagues during shift changes also helps maintain smooth operations.

About the role:
The Part-Time Overnight House Attendant is responsible for maintaining cleanliness and organization throughout guest corridors, housekeeping support areas, and public spaces during overnight operations. This role supports the Housekeeping team by stocking supplies, handling guest requests, maintaining linen inventories, and ensuring all areas are prepared for the following day's operations. This position is part of the Housekeeping team, reporting to Housekeeping Management.
What you will do:
  • Maintain cleanliness and presentation of guest corridors, stairwells, service elevator landings, linen rooms, and housekeeping support areas

  • Vacuum, dust, sweep, and mop designated areas to ensure a clean and welcoming environment

  • Stock linen rooms, storage areas, and housekeeping armoires with clean linens, amenities, and guest supplies

  • Move clean linen to guest room floors and remove soiled linen and trash from housekeeping areas

  • Assist overnight with guest requests including cribs, rollaway beds, refrigerators, and additional amenities

  • Prepare and maintain large-format bath amenities and bottled water supplies for daily operations

  • Support Housekeeping team members with moving furniture, beds, mattresses, and other heavy items as needed

  • Deliver guest-requested items promptly and professionally

  • Assist with Guest Room Attendant, Turndown Attendant, and Lobby Attendant responsibilities during high-demand periods

  • Maintain housekeeping carts, closets, and storage areas at proper inventory levels

  • Follow all housekeeping, safety, and cleanliness procedures and standards
  • Communicate guest requests and operational needs to management promptly
